About 4-[4-[1,3-benzothiazol-2-ylcarbamoyl(3,3-diphenylpropyl)amino]butylcarbamoyl]piperidine-1-carboxylic acid

4-[4-[1,3-benzothiazol-2-ylcarbamoyl(3,3-diphenylpropyl)amino]butylcarbamoyl]piperidine-1-carboxylic acid (PubChem CID 91166202) has the molecular formula C34H39N5O4S and a molecular weight of 613.78 g/mol. Its IUPAC name is 4-[4-[1,3-benzothiazol-2-ylcarbamoyl(3,3-diphenylpropyl)amino]butylcarbamoyl]piperidine-1-carboxylic acid.
